For calculations of CoC, the genome was divided into 25 kb bins. The frequency of Cytoplasm Inhibitors MedChemExpress events in each bin was calculated, too as the frequency with which any two pairs of bins around the very same chromosome each contained events inside the very same tetrad. The anticipated frequency of such double events beneath a model of no interference is the solution with the individual event frequencies inside the two bins. The CoC for each pair of bins may be the ratio on the observed frequency of double events to the anticipated frequency. This ratio was calculated for all bin pairs having a non-zero expected frequency, and benefits have been averaged for all bin pairs separated by a provided distance. In Fig six and S8 Fig, only the outcomes for adjacent bin pairs are plotted. A chi-square test was made use of to compare anticipated and observed double COs.
